3.5.6. Accumulator and Chainout Adder
The Arria® V variable precision DSP block supports a 64-bit accumulator and a 64-bit adder.
For Arria® V GX, GT, SX, and ST devices, the accumulator and chainout adder features are not supported in two independent 18 x 19 modes and three independent 9 x 9 modes.
For Arria® V GZ devices, you can use the 64-bit adder as full adder.
The following signals can dynamically control the function of the accumulator:
- NEGATE
- LOADCONST
- ACCUMULATE
Function | Description | NEGATE | LOADCONST | ACCUMULATE |
---|---|---|---|---|
Zeroing | Disables the accumulator. |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Preload | Loads an initial value to the accumulator. Only one bit of the 64-bit preload value can be “1”. It can be used as rounding the DSP result to any position of the 64-bit result. | 0 | 1 | 0 |
Accumulation | Adds the current result to the previous accumulate result. | 0 | X | 1 |
Decimation | This function takes the current result, converts it into two’s complement, and adds it to the previous result. | 1 | X | 1 |
